Job Requirements:
- Solid understanding of Core Java Concepts such as Object Oriented
Programming, Java Collections API, Exception Handling, Multi-Threading is
required - Solid understanding of Object Oriented Analysis, J2EE Concepts, Architecture,
and Technologies - Proficiency with JavaScript, HTML5 and CSS
- Thorough understanding of the responsibilities of the entire platform;
database, API, caching layer, proxies, and other web services used in the
system - Deep knowledge of Angular Platform practices and commonly used
modules based on extensive work experience - Creating custom, general use modules and components which extend the
elements and modules of core Angular Platform - Experience with OR Mappers, preferably Hibernate
- Experience implementing RESTful and/or traditional web services using technologies such as JSON, SOAP, and XML
- Working knowledge of J2EE Application Development and related tools and technologies such as Eclipse, Application Servers (Websphere, JBoss).
Minimum Qualifications:
- Bachelor’s Degree or equivalent plus seven (7) year of related experience
- Minimum of five (5) years’ experience with writing Java application software,
Java/J2EE, JSP, JPA, Spring, Hibernate, Eclipse, WebSphere Application Server
(WAS), Tomcat, SOAP, Rational Team Concert, and DB2 - Minimum of three (3) years hands on experience with Angular 2 or higher
framework, HTML, CSS, javascript and bootstrap